Global Structure of the Phase Orbit of Nonlinear Differential Equations with a Center
Tang Jiashi.Global Structure of the Phase Orbit of Nonlinear Differential Equations with a Center[J].Journal of Hunan University(Naturnal Science),1992,19(3):68-74.
Authors:Tang Jiashi
Institution:Tang Jiashi Department of Engineering Mechanics
Abstract:If the singular point of linear differentiaI equations is the center, after adding nonlinear terms the singular point may still be the center or become a focus owing to the change of the topological structure. This paper discusses the global structure of the orbit in the phase plane of the nonlinear differential equation with only one singular point. We show that in the global fieds the topological structure of the phase orbit may be one of the following cases: 1) It is a bunch of the closed orbits around the singular point. 2) It is the spiral curve around the singular point. 3) There exist one or two demarcation lines. It is a bunch of the closed orbits around the singular point inside tho demarcation line and the dispersed orbit outside the demarcation line. 4) There is no limit cycle.
